  • The order of operations is a set of rules that dictate the order in which mathematical operations are performed. It's often remembered using the acronym PEMDAS: Parentheses, Exponents, Multiplication and Division, and Addition and Subtraction.

      Simplifying an expression involves combining like terms, canceling out common factors, and reducing complex operations to their simplest form. For example, 2x + 3x can be simplified to 5x by combining like terms.

    • An expression is a combination of numbers, variables, and operations that conveys a specific idea, while an equation is a statement that says two expressions are equal. For instance, 2x + 3 = 5 is an equation, while 2x + 3 is an expression.
